python时间轮播

未收录

Python时间轮播是一种强大的工具,能够帮助开发者在应用中高效处理时间相关任务。本文将从多个角度深入探讨这一主题,通过生动的个人案例和活泼的语气,带领读者领略其魅力。

python时间轮播

1、时间轮播的基本概念

时间轮播不仅仅是简单的时间处理工具,它像魔法一样可以简化我们的编程生活。想象一下,当你需要每隔一段时间执行某项任务时,时间轮播可以如同你的私人提醒小助手,时刻等待着指令。

我第一次接触时间轮播是在一个大数据处理项目中,我们需要定期清理和分析数十亿行数据。使用Python的时间轮播模块,我们不仅成功实现了定时任务的调度,还大大提高了处理效率。

在实际应用中,有时候小错误会发生,比如写错了时间单位,结果任务早早地执行了。幸运的是,Python社区总是有一些奇技淫巧可以帮你解决这些问题。

2、时间轮播的应用场景

时间轮播的应用场景十分广泛,从简单的定时任务到复杂的数据清理和分析,无所不能。例如,我曾经在一个电商项目中使用时间轮播来定期更新商品库存和价格信息,确保在线商店的信息时刻保持最新。

不过,有时候即使是最小的时间单位错误也可能引发灾难。就像一次我设置了一个每小时执行的任务,但忘记了考虑夏令时的影响,结果造成了一些数据处理上的混乱。

但无论如何,时间轮播的灵活性和功能强大,始终能够帮助开发者解决各种时间相关的问题。

3、时间轮播的技术实现

技术实现方面,时间轮播通常依赖于Python的第三方库如APScheduler。这些库提供了丰富的API,使得我们可以轻松地配置和管理定时任务。

我曾经在一个社交媒体应用中使用了APScheduler来管理用户发布的动态内容的生命周期。通过合理设置时间轮播任务,我们成功地实现了动态内容的自动下线和清理,节省了大量的服务器资源。

但有时候即使最牛的程序员也会遇到奇奇怪怪的问题,比如一次我设置的任务竟然没有按时执行,原来是因为服务器时间与本地时间有所偏差。

4、时间轮播的优势与挑战

时间轮播的优势在于其简单易用和高效性,然而使用中也会遇到一些挑战。例如,我们在一个医疗系统中使用时间轮播来定时更新病人检测数据,确保医生能够及时查看最新结果。

但有时候哪怕一丁点的错误也会让事情发生戏剧性的变化,比如一次我们的时间轮播任务频率设置错了一个零,导致病人数据更新的频率大大加快,医生们差点被数据淹没。

时间轮播的优势远大于挑战,关键在于合理规划和谨慎设置任务。

5、时间轮播的未来发展

未来,随着人工智能和物联网技术的发展,时间轮播将扮演更加重要的角色。我相信,它将不仅仅局限于软件开发,可能会在更多的智能设备和自动化系统中得到应用。

就像一次我设想的未来场景,智能家居中的设备通过时间轮播自动调整能耗,根据家庭成员的日常行为预测性地管理能源使用。

然而,现实总是充满意外,我们有时候需要接受一些“时间轮播的宇宙级错误”,比如一次智能家居系统自动打开了所有灯光,因为我们忘记了一个时间轮播任务的有效期设置。

6、结语

通过本文的探索,我们对Python时间轮播有了更深入的了解。它不仅是一种技术工具,更是我们编程生活中的一位忠实助手。在未来的路上,让我们与时间轮播一同探索,创造更多令人惊叹的应用吧!

Python时间轮播不仅在现有技术领域中发挥着重要作用,未来还有巨大的潜力等待开发者们去挖掘和创新。

这篇文章按照要求以HTML格式呈现,深入探讨了Python时间轮播的各个方面,包括基本概念、应用场景、技术实现、优势与挑战、未来发展和结语,每个部分都结合了个人经验和幽默风趣的语言表达。

更多 推荐文章